If this is a corrupted filename, it might be the result of a file sharing process gone wrong. Often, when files are shared on older Peer-to-Peer networks or zipped and unzipped multiple times, filenames get truncated. A file originally named "[FCV] Giantess Video 8039 [Full].mp4" could easily mutate into the monstrous string we see today.

At its core, the Giantess genre is a subset of speculative fiction and fantasy. It explores the power dynamics, visual scale, and surreal perspectives of individuals—usually women—who are hundreds or thousands of feet tall.
